>>61755694Line any bowl shiny side up with aluminium foil, put the silver in contact with it, pour baking soda on it, then pour very hot water on it and wait.

>>61755694>is the stainless bowl a necessary part?I just use a ceramic (corelle) bowl, but even an aluminum foil pie plate would work, teflon frying pan, glass bowl, etc. The key componets are the aluminum foil(anode), silver sulfide(cathode), water and baking soda or sodium carbonate (electrolyte).You're actually making a battery that reduces silver sulfide to elemental silver and aluminum to aluminum sulfide.
